Added by Callofduty4The SOF Combat Assault Rifle-Heavy, or SCAR-H, is a modular, modern battle rifle made by FN Herstal. The SCAR-H differs from the SCAR-L in that it is classified as an adaptive battle rifle rather than an assault rifle, and utilizes a smaller, 20-round box magazine over the lighter version's 30 round STANAG, aswell as the larger 7.62x51mm round, and longer barrel.

Battlefield 2
Edit
The SCAR-H appears in Battlefield 2: Special Forces as the standard weapon for the United States Navy SEALs Assault Kit. The SCAR-H comes with standard frag grenades, instead of a 40mm under-barrel grenade launcher. The SCAR-H appears to have higher accuracy and higher damage than any other assault rifles except the Chinese AK-47 and MEC AK-101.

The SCAR-H returns in Battlefield 3, as the SCAR-H CQB variant.
Singleplayer
Edit
The SCAR-H is the starting weapons in Operation Guillotine, it is also found in the mission Kaffarov once the player enters the building.
Multiplayer
Edit
It is classified as a carbine and is issued to the Engineer kit as the third unlockable item.
The SCAR-H has moderately high damage and an average rate of fire, offset by its high amount of recoil, which becomes a real problem at a distance. Therefore, burst firing is strongly recommended. The SCAR-H performs much like a PDW in CQB, where the weapon will be able to kill multiple enemies in a choke point. Its ironsights are partially obstructed, therefore it is recommended the player either hipfires or attaches an optic. When equipped with an optic, a bipod/foregrip to reduce recoil and a suppressor, the SCAR-H will be an extremely flexible weapon that will be able to challenge assault rifles at medium range.
